Our sessions together

You are the expert in you. The questions I ask will help you to explore yourself and release your potential. In metaphorical terms I will help you to come back to yourself by reconciling and re-uniting those parts that have become separate (e.g. emotional baggage, blocks, shields, bubbles, walls, lost children, lost hope, critics and observers). I will also help you let go of anything that doesn't belong to or serve you (e.g. other people's emotions, beliefs, disapproval and responsibility; unwanted attachments; black clouds; heavy weights; and other assorted 'weird' stuff).

Every session is different but may well include some modeling ("And whereabouts in your stomach is that knot?", "And when you see a bird, then what happens?); dialoguing ("And if Fred was here now ... what would you like to be able to say to him?"); time line work ("Imagine floating way up above your life ... and back to the first time that it ever happened ..."); spatial work ("Move to a space in the room that knows about ..."); visualisaiton ("And if you were to imagine being there now ..."); technique learning (such as 'ha' breathing, meridian tapping or peripheral vision); or even some time spent resting in 'nothing'.

As we work together our sessions tend to find their own natural flow. I make much use of my intuition (ideas from a higher place) and empathy (feeling your feelings). It is not unusual for clients to have some deep emotional release / spiritual experiences.
